Gauge theory on Aloff–Wallach spaces

Gavin Ball and Goncalo Oliveira

Geometry & Topology 23 (2019) 685–743
Abstract

For gauge groups U(1) and SO(3) we classify invariant G2 –instantons for homogeneous coclosed G2 –structures on Aloff–Wallach spaces Xk,l. As a consequence, we give examples where G2 –instantons can be used to distinguish between different strictly nearly parallel G2 –structures on the same Aloff–Wallach space. In addition to this, we find that while certain G2 –instantons exist for the strictly nearly parallel G2 –structure on X1,1, no such G2 –instantons exist for the 3–Sasakian one. As a further consequence of the classification, we produce examples of some other interesting phenomena, such as irreducible G2 –instantons that, as the structure varies, merge into the same reducible and obstructed one and G2 –instantons on nearly parallel G2 –manifolds that are not locally energy-minimizing.
